Who are group classes for?
Group classes are for young students ages 2-8 who enjoy playing games & learning songs with others. They are a wonderful addition to private music lessons, but students do not need to play an instrument in order to attend. These classes will set them up for success if they choose to play an instrument later by expanding their musical repertoire & teaching basic concepts such as steady beat & pitch!
​
What will we learn?
In group classes, kids will be taught music through folk songs, singing games, movement, & ear training. Using a discovery-based, sound to symbol approach, they will be prepared to read, write & recognize music.
